Hello,

I upgraded my proxmox system from 7.4 to 8.1.5, after the update process the samba shares stopped working. I removed the whole samba package, but I couln't resintall them again. Is there any way to revive the samba service?

Have you tried adding a SAMBA share from the GUI? Datacenter, Add: SMB/CIFS

If the packages have been removed try:

apt update, apt dist-upgrade & then apt install samba
